    Push left on the dpad while on defense and it will give you the option of how you want your guys to play....defensive strategy

    Just be mindful that if you tell them to pressure shooters, then the computer players will start driving around your defenders. This works for me cause I'm a pg on the bucks and I have Larry Sanders behind me cleaning up any defensive mistakes we might make

    So you may not want to try it if you don't have a defensive anchor or good defenders. I did this against the heat and the very first play, Lebron drove by caron butler and before any of us could react he dunked it on him for the and 1

    but we did win 113-111 with me making the game winning free throws after mario chalmers fouled me with one sec left and the heat having no time outs

Moving on.... I think I've found the greatest sig skill ever: On Court Coach. Might cost 10k VC, but it's worth it. You can call plays when not a PG and they pass it to you nearly every single time you call for it. It even seems that my teammates play better with this skill equipped.
